Summary

Right-handed pitcher Michael Senay has committed to Alabama after transferring from USF. Recent reports indicate that he earned a place on the American Conference All-Freshman Team this season, finishing with a 5-2 record and a 3.58 ERA over 70 1/3 innings. Senay recorded 49 strikeouts with just 11 walks, showcasing his potential for the Crimson Tide, who just made their sixth trip to the Men’s College World Series. His addition is expected to bolster Alabama's pitching lineup as they prepare for upcoming competitions.
